The Monarch Award: Illinois’ K-3 Children’s Choice Award is presented annually to the author and/or illustrator of the book voted as their favorite by students in Kindergarten through Grade Three in participating Illinois schools or public libraries. The Monarch is sponsored by the Illinois School Library Association.
The name Monarch (butterfly) was chosen because of its familiarity to K-3 children and to symbolize the growth, change and freedom that becoming a reader brings. The Monarch is designed to encourage children to read critically and become familiar with children's books, authors and illustrators. The program is open to all K-3 age children in Illinois.
Each year a committee creates a list of 20 books to be read by the children. The titles include a range of interest and reading levels for grades K-3. The list contains picture books, easy readers, and chapter books. Students are encouraged to read books from the list during the school year.

The Rebecca Caudill Young Readers' Book Award was developed to encourage children and young adults to read for personal satisfaction. It is an Illinois award for outstanding literature for young people and is sponsored by the Illinois Reading Council, the Illinois School Library Media Association, and the Illinois Association of Teachers of English.

BATTLE OF THE BOOKS (What is it?) |
This is a reading program sponsored by the Wheaton Public Library in which students from different schools read books from a selected list, form teams representing their schools, and play against other local schools in a College-Bowl type format.
The new season for 4th and 5th grade begins in January. Lincoln, St. John, St. Michael and Wheaton Christian Grammar School are participating.
